Abstract

The embodiment of the invention provides a Micro USB (Universal Serial Bus) connector for a mobile terminal. The Micro USB connector comprises a protective shell, a butting part, a sealed plastic shell and a fixed shell, wherein the protective shell is provided with an accommodating space, and a first opening and a second opening which are positioned at the two ends of the accommodating space; the butting part is arranged in the accommodating space; the butting part comprises an insulating body and a plurality of terminals which are inserted into the insulating body; the plurality of terminals pass through the first opening; the sealed plastic shell seals and surrounds the outer surface of the protective shell and the first opening; the fixed shell is arranged between the protective shell and the sealed plastic shell and is used for fixing the protective shell on a printed circuit board; the protective shell, the butting part, the sealed plastic shell and the fixed shell are integrally molded in an in-mold injection mode. The embodiment of the invention also provides the mobile terminal. By the mode, the mobile terminal and the Micro USB connector thereof can prevent water from entering the mobile terminal through the Micro USB connector so as to improve the waterproof grade of the mobile terminal.

Background technology
In September, 2007, open mobile-terminal platform (Open Mobile Terminal Platform, OMTP) announced that global unified charger for mobile phone interface standard is Micro USB, USB technology on the new portable terminals such as Micro USB standard support mobile phone is for littler, compacter from now on portable terminal is got ready.Various portable terminals such as mobile phone, MP4, digital camera can carry out interconnected, communication under without the situation of PC transfer.The Micro USB interface will become the unified charging inlet of following mobile phone etc., and the use of Micro USB interface makes that an interface can charge, audio frequency and data connect.
Because the environment difference that product uses, different product is also different to the performance requirement of Micro USB connector, the existing portable terminal of Micro USB connector that uses all can not be supported to immerse in the water, when portable terminal immerses in the water, water can enter to portable terminal inside from the Micro USB connector, causes the short circuit of mobile terminal circuit plate and damages.This portable terminal water resistance is poor, and classification of waterproof is low.

See also Fig. 1 and Fig. 2, Fig. 1 is the exploded perspective structural representation of Micro USB connector embodiment of the present invention, and Fig. 2 is the combining structure schematic diagram of Micro USB connector shown in Figure 1.This Micro USB connector comprises protection housing 10, docking section 20, seals and mould shell 30 and stationary housing 40.
Protection housing 10 has an accommodation space 11, is positioned at first opening 12 and second opening (not indicating) at these accommodation space 11 two ends, and simultaneously, the end face 14 of this protection housing 10 is formed with two through holes 15 of parallel interval.
Docking section 20 is located in this accommodation space 11; some terminals 22 that docking section 20 comprises insulating body 21 and is inserted in this insulating body 21; these some terminals 22 pass first opening 12; be used for electrically connecting with the printed circuit board (PCB) (not shown); further; this insulating body 21 comprises base portion 211 and gives prominence to the tongue pieces 212 that form along base portion 211; tongue piece 212 is used for some terminals 22 are fixed on protection housing 10; in the present embodiment; in-mould injection has steel disc when tongue piece 212 moulding, to strengthen the intensity of tongue piece 212.
See also Fig. 3 and Fig. 4, Fig. 3 is the plan structure schematic diagram of Micro USB connector shown in Figure 1, and Fig. 4 is that Micro USB connector shown in Figure 3 is along the cross-sectional schematic of A-A direction.In the present embodiment, protection housing 10 inside are provided with elastic bumps 16, when being used for inserting butt connector, and protection tongue piece 212.Particularly, this elastic bumps 16 has two, and it is inner near base portion 211 places to be located at protection housing 10.
Sealing is moulded shell 30 and will be protected housing 10 outer surfaces and 12 sealings of first opening to surround; this second opening can be pegged graft for the butt connector (not shown); in the present embodiment; sealing is moulded shell 30 and this first opening 12 corresponding one sides and is provided with some holes (indicating), and these some holes can supply some terminals 22 pass to electrically connect with printed circuit board (PCB).Sealing is moulded shell 30 contiguous second openings and is formed with annular groove 31, annular groove 31 is arranged with sealing ring 50(and sees also Fig. 4), sealing ring 50 is used for the gap that shell 30 and portable terminal cooperation place are moulded in the sealing sealing, in the present embodiment, sealing ring 50 is rubber sleeve, can certainly be other elastic articles that seal.
Stationary housing 40 is located between protection housing 10 and the seal casinghousing 30.Particularly, stationary housing 40 is preferably the metal material of iron or ferroalloy, stationary housing 40 comprises that body 41, first inserts pin 42, second and inserts pin 43, the 3rd insertion pin 44 and the 4th insertion pin 45, body 41 is formed with two convex closures 46, the first insertion pin 42 and second inserts pin 43 and is bent to form along the dual-side of body 41 respectively, one side the 3rd insertion pin 44 and the 4th inserts pin 45 along being bent to form with the adjacent of this dual-side.The body 41 of stationary housing 40 is covered in the end face 14 of protection housing 10; two through holes 15 of these two convex closures, 46 corresponding coverings; stationary housing 40 inserts pin 42, the second insertion pin 43, the 3rd insertion pin 44 and the 4th insertion pin 45 by first and will protect housing 10 to be fixedly welded on the printed circuit board (PCB); in the present embodiment; in order to increase weld strength, the first insertion pin 42, the second insertion pin 43, the 3rd insertion pin 44 and the 4th insertion pin 45 are provided with through hole 47 away from an end of body 41.
What deserves to be explained is; in the present embodiment; shell 30 is moulded in protection housing 10, docking section 20, sealing and stationary housing 40 adopts in-mould injection (Insert Molding) one-body molded; in-mould injection is a kind of forming technique of making step of simplifying; mainly referred to before using plastics filling die cavity; earlier insert (metal, plastic cement etc.) is inserted in the die cavity; so; insert and plastic (plastics) may be molded to one; save procedure of processings such as stickup or assembling, embed the method for forming and be widely used in the various products.Adopt the in-mould injection moulding can strengthen the overall structure of Micro USB connector, and sealing is further guaranteed.
Below in conjunction with accompanying drawing 1 to 4, describe the course of work of this Micro USB connector in detail.
Sealing is moulded shell 30 and will be protected housing 10 outer surfaces and 12 sealings of first opening to surround; pin 43, the 3rd inserts pin 44 and the 4th insertion pin 45 is connected to printed circuit board (PCB) from these some holes from passing so that the first insertion pin 42, second of some terminals 22 and stationary housing 40 inserts only to leave some holes; but because in the present embodiment; shell 30 is moulded in protection housing 10, docking section 20, sealing and stationary housing 40 adopts in-mould injections one-body molded, all can keep good sealing property in the cooperation place of these some holes and some terminals 22, stationary housing 40.Further, be coated with convex closure 46 at the through hole 15 of protecting housing 10, be arranged with sealing ring 50 in this Micro USB connector and portable terminal cooperation place.By above design, the inventor is through test of many times, the dustproof and waterproof grade of being furnished with the portable terminal of this Micro USB connector can reach the IP67 level, when portable terminal immerses in the water, water can not enter into portable terminal inside from the Micro USB connector, can not enter portable terminal inside from Micro USB connector and portable terminal cooperation place.
The portable terminal of the embodiment of the invention and Micro USB connector thereof are moulded shell 30 by sealing and will be protected housing 10 outer surfaces and 12 sealings of first opening to surround, even make that water enters this Micro USB connector inside, also can't enter portable terminal.Simultaneously, shell 30 and the one-body molded water resistance that has improved stability of structure and further improved this Micro USB connector of stationary housing 40 employing in-mould injections are moulded in protection housing 10, docking section 20, sealing.
